West Palm Beach (Florida) has no state income tax, boosting take-home vs Bismarck (ND rate: 2.5%).

Is $120K a good salary in West Palm Beach?

At $120K/year in West Palm Beach, your estimated monthly take-home is $7,155. With 1BR rent around $2,400/month, rent takes up 34% of your take-home. That's considered manageable.

Is $120K a good salary in Bismarck?

At $120K/year in Bismarck, your estimated monthly take-home is $6,905. With 1BR rent around $1,150/month, rent takes up 17% of your take-home. That's considered very comfortable.

Which city is more affordable on a $120K salary?

Bismarck le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$5,127/month vs $3,970/month in West Palm Beach.
